From one of the most senior correspondents in the Canberra Press Gallery comes a rare account of life as a political insider. Born in a small village in Cyprus, Niki Savva spent her childhood in Melbournes working-class suburbs - frontiers where locals were suspicious of olive oil, and Greek kids spoke Gringlish to their parents.
